ServiceNow, Inc. (NYSE:NOW - Get Free Report) CFO Gina Mastantuono sold 292 shares of the stock in a transaction on Friday, August 8th. The stock was sold at an average price of $878.39, for a total value of $256,489.88. Following the sale, the chief financial officer directly owned 11,551 shares of the company's stock, valued at approximately $10,146,282.89. This represents a 2.47% decrease in their ownership of the stock. The sale was disclosed in a document filed with the Securities & Exchange Commission, which is available at the SEC website.

Gina Mastantuono also recently made the following trade(s):

  • On Tuesday, May 13th, Gina Mastantuono sold 84 shares of ServiceNow stock. The shares were sold at an average price of $1,023.00, for a total transaction of $85,932.00.

ServiceNow Stock Down 1.9%

Shares of NOW traded down $16.56 during midday trading on Monday, reaching $855.95. 2,368,911 shares of the company were exchanged, compared to its average volume of 1,696,838. ServiceNow, Inc. has a 1-year low of $678.66 and a 1-year high of $1,198.09. The stock has a 50-day moving average price of $982.92 and a 200-day moving average price of $942.17. The company has a current ratio of 1.09, a quick ratio of 1.09 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.14. The company has a market cap of $178.04 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 107.80, a P/E/G ratio of 3.93 and a beta of 0.93.

ServiceNow (NYSE:NOW - Get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, July 23rd. The information technology services provider reported $4.09 earnings per share for the quarter, topping analysts' consensus estimates of $3.57 by $0.52. ServiceNow had a return on equity of 18.04% and a net margin of 13.78%. The firm had revenue of $3.22 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ts' expectations of $3.12 billion. During the same quarter in the prior year, the business earned $3.13 EPS. ServiceNow's quarterly revenue was up 22.4% compared to the same quarter last year. Research analysts expect that ServiceNow, Inc. will post 8.93 earnings per share for the current year.

Institutional Investors Weigh In On ServiceNow

Several hedge funds and other institutional investors have recently added to or reduced their stakes in NOW. Empirical Finance LLC raised its holdings in ServiceNow by 0.8% in the second quarter. Empirical Finance LLC now owns 6,726 shares of the information technology services provider's stock valued at $6,915,000 after acquiring an additional 51 shares in the last quarter. Alteri Wealth LLC raised its stake in shares of ServiceNow by 1.7% in the 2nd quarter. Alteri Wealth LLC now owns 855 shares of the information technology services provider's stock valued at $879,000 after purchasing an additional 14 shares in the last quarter. VSM Wealth Advisory LLC bought a new position in shares of ServiceNow during the second quarter worth about $43,000. FineMark National Bank & Trust grew its stake in ServiceNow by 2.7% in the second quarter. FineMark National Bank & Trust now owns 12,517 shares of the information technology services provider's stock worth $12,868,000 after purchasing an additional 326 shares in the last quarter. Finally, Stonebrook Private Inc. increased its holdings in ServiceNow by 5.7% in the second quarter. Stonebrook Private Inc. now owns 668 shares of the information technology services provider's stock valued at $687,000 after buying an additional 36 shares during the last quarter. Hedge funds and other institutional investors own 87.18% of the company's stock.

Analysts Set New Price Targets

NOW has been the subject of a number of recent analyst reports. Oppenheimer restated an "outperform" rating and issued a $1,150.00 price objective (up previously from $1,100.00) on shares of ServiceNow in a research report on Thursday, July 24th. Mizuho lifted their price target on ServiceNow from $1,050.00 to $1,100.00 and gave the company an "outperform" rating in a research note on Thursday, June 12th. Morgan Stanley reiterated an "equal weight" rating on shares of ServiceNow in a research report on Tuesday, July 8th. Piper Sandler boosted their target price on shares of ServiceNow from $1,120.00 to $1,150.00 and gave the stock an "overweight" rating in a research report on Thursday, July 24th. Finally, Canaccord Genuity Group reduced their price objective on shares of ServiceNow from $1,275.00 to $900.00 and set a "buy" rating for the company in a research note on Tuesday, April 22nd. One equities research analyst has rated the stock with a sell rating, three have given a hold rating, thirty have issued a buy rating and one has issued a strong buy rating to the stock. Based on data from MarketBeat.com, the stock currently has an average rating of "Moderate Buy" and an average target price of $1,115.20.

About ServiceNow

(Get Free Report)

ServiceNow, Inc provides end to-end intelligent workflow automation platform solutions for digital businesses in the North America, Europe, the Middle East and Africa, Asia Pacific, and internationally. The company operates the Now platform for end-to-end digital transformation, artificial intelligence, machine learning, robotic process automation, process mining, performance analytics, and collaboration and development tools.
